A.  There shall be only one class of shares of a professional accounting corporation, denominated common shares which shall be either with or without par value.

B.  The ownership of shares in a professional accounting corporation shall be subject to the provisions of the Louisiana Accountancy Act.

C.  Repealed by Acts 2000, 1st Ex. Sess., No. 30, §2, eff. April 14, 2000.

D.  R.S. 12:78 shall not apply to professional accounting corporations.

Added by Acts 1970, No. 191, §1.  Amended by Acts 1972, No. 82, §1; Acts 2000, 1st Ex. Sess., No. 30, §§1, 2, eff. April 14, 2000.
